  • This paper addresses that an approximation and tracking control of realtime recurrent neural networks(RTRN) using two-dimensional iterative teaming algorithm for an electro-hydraulic servo system. Two dimensional learning rule is driven in the discrete system which consists of nonlinear output fuction and linear input. In order to control the trajectory of position, two RTRN with the same network architecture were used. Simulation results show that two RTRN using 2-D learning algorithm are able to approximate the plant output and desired trajectory to a very high degree of a accuracy respectively and the control algorithm using two identical RTRN was very effective to trajectory tracking of the electro-hydraulic servo system.

  • The computed-torque method (CTM) shows good trajectory tracking performance in controlling robot manipulator if there is no disturbance or modelling errors. But with the increase of a payload or the disturbance of a manipulator, the tracking errors become large. So there have been many researchs to reduce the tracking error. In this paper, we propose a new control algorithm based on the CTM that decreases a tracking error by generating new reference trajectory to the controller. In this algorithm we used a fuzzy system based on the rule bases. For the numerical simulation, we used a 2-link robot manipulator. To simulate the disturbance due to a modelling uncertainty, we added errors to each elements of the inertia matrix and the nonlinear terms and assumed a payload to the end-effector. In the simulations of several cases, our method showed better trajectory tracking performance compared with the CTM.

  • In this paper, we present an iterative learning control (ILC) framework for tracking problems with predefined data points that are desired points at certain time instants. To design ILC systems for such problems, a new ILC scheme is proposed to produce output curves that pass close to the desired points. Unlike traditional ILC approaches, an algorithm will be developed in which the control signals are generated by solving an optimal ILC problem with respect to the desired sampling points. In another word, it is a direct approach for the multiple points tracking ILC control problem where we do not need to divide the tracking problem into two steps separately as trajectory planning and ILC controller.The strength of the proposed formulation is the methodology to obtain a control signal through learning law only considering the given data points and dynamic system, instead of following the direction of tracking a prior identified trajectory. The key advantage of the proposed approach is to significantly reduce the computational cost. Finally, simulation results will be introduced to confirm the effectiveness of proposed scheme.

  • Adaptive anti-sway and trajectory tracking control of overhead crane is presented, which utilizes Fuzzy Uncertainty Observer(FUO) and Fuzzy based Variable Structure Control(FVSC). We consider an overhead crane system which can be decoupled into the actuated and unactuated subsystems with its own lumped uncertainty such as parameter uncertainties and external disturbance. First, a new method for anti-sway control using FVSC is proposed to improve the conventional method based on Lyapunov direct method, while a conventional trajectory tracking control law using feedback linearization is directly adopted. Second, FUO is designed to estimate one of the two lumped uncertainties which can compensate both of them, based on the fact that two lumped uncertainties are coupled with each other. Then, an adaptive anti-sway control is proposed by incorporating the proposed FVSC and FUO. Under the condition that the observation error is Uniformly Ultimately Bounded(UUB) within an arbitrarily shrinkable region, the overall closed-loop system is shown to be Globally Uniformly Ultimately Bounded(GUUB). In addition, the Global Asymptotic Stability(GAS) of it is shown under the vanishing disturbance assumption. Finally, the effectiveness of the proposed scheme has been confirmed by numerical simulations.

  • A pneumatic artificial muscle type of actuator, which acts similar to human muscle, is developed recently. In this paper, an adaptive controller is presented for the trajectory tracking problem of a two-degree- of-freedom manipulator using two pairs of pneumatic artificial muscle actuators. Due to the nonlinearity and the uncertainty on the dynamics of the actuator, it is difficult to make the effective control schemes of this system. By the adaptive control law which inclueds a nonlinear "feedforward" term compensating paramet- ric uncertainties in addition to P.I.D. scheme, both golbal stability of the system and convergence of the tracking error are guaranted. The effectiveness of the proposed control method for the manipulator using this actuator is illustrated through experiments.periments.

  • The PID trajectory tracking controller for robotic systems shows performance limitation imposed by inverse dynamics according to desired trajectory. Since the equilibrium point can not be defined for the control system involving performance limitation, we define newly the quasi-equilibrium region as an alternative for equilibrium point. This analysis result of performance limitation can guide us the auto-tuning method for PID controller. Also, the quasi-equilibrium region is used as the target performance of auto-tuning PID trajectory tracking controller. The auto-tuning law is derived from the direct adaptive control scheme, based on the extended disturbance input-to-state stability and the characteristics of performance limitation. Finally, experimental results show that the target performance can be achieved by the proposed automatic tuning method.

  • In this study, position and force simultaneous trajectory tracking control apparatus with pneumatic cylinder driving system is proposed. The pneumatic cylinder driving system that consists of two pneumatic cylinders constrained in series and two proportional flow control valves offers a considerable advantage as to non-interaction of the actuators because of the low stiffness of the pneumatic actuators. The controller applied to the driving system is composed of a non-interaction controller to compensate for interaction of two cylinders and a disturbance observer to reduce the effect of model discrepancy of the driving system in the low frequency range that cannot be suppressed by the non-interaction controller. The experimental results with the proposed control apparatus show that the interacting effects of two cylinders are eliminated remarkably and the proposed control apparatus tracks the given position and force trajectory accurately.

  • In this paper, the design and the implementation of a robust adaptive controller for trajectory tracking of robot manipulator is presented. The proposed control scheme ensures that tracking errors are converged to some boundaries in the presence of a state-dependent input disturbances as well as the ideal case without any prior knowledge of the robot manipulator parameters. The 3 DOF robot manipulator including actuator dynamics is used for the implementation of the proposed control scheme. The experimental results show that the proposed control scheme is valid for trajectory tracking of the robot manipulator.
